Starting college is a difficult transition for many students. Here are some ways to make the transition a little bit easier.
Get involved.
By joining a team, you not only get to meet older students who can help you get through the transition, you also make friends quickly and have things to do. One of the huge differences from high school to college is the amount of free time you have.
Have an open mind.
Especially if you are going to a bigger school, it's important to have an open mind. Yet when you get to college, there are people from all over that have different views on things and act in a different way.
Stay focused.
It is so easy to get caught up in your social life and forget about the academics. Remain focused on your schoolwork and figure out what you want to study, but be sure to have time for social activities as well.
Take care of your body. Being away from home and no longer having parents looking after you doesn't mean you have to throw away all the things you learned about staying healthy. Eat healthily and play sports as you did in high school to stay in shape.
Again, the transition from high school to college can be extremely challenging. By following some of these tips, hopefully your transition will be a little smoother and you will get the most out of your freshman year in college!
